The nucleotide sequences defining the signal peptides of the galactose-binding protein and the arabinose-binding protein.

J B Scripture, R W Hogg.   

Abstract

The nucleotide sequences of the NH2-terminal regions of the mglB (galactose-binding protein) and the araF (arabinose-binding protein) genes have been determined. A "signal peptide" containing 23 amino acid residues immediately precedes the known sequence of the processed galactose-binding protein. The primary sequence of the signal peptide of the arabinose-binding protein has been redefined according to the established nucleotide sequence. The nucleotide sequences for the two signal peptides are preceded by apparent ribosome-binding sequences.
